Smith made the Houston Astros’ Opening Day roster, three league sources told The Athletic on Tuesday, completing his six-week captivation of an entire coaching staff and clubhouse. The 22-year-old phenom is expected to start in right field on Thursday when Houston hosts the New York Mets at Daikin Park.
